Goodyear breaks ground at Kelly's Fayetteville site
Fayetteville, North Carolina--Goodyear Tire and Rubber has broken ground on two expansion projects at its Kelly-Springfield factory in Fayetteville, North Carolina.
The company plans to expand its warehouses and to add capacity for large light truck tyres for wheels in sizes up to up to 20-inches. The latter project represents $30 million investment, while the warehouse is a further $17 million.
